However, it can be difficult to connect with this demographic, given the changing landscape of technology. In this article, we will discuss some practical ways to engage young fans in football.


First and foremost, it is crucial to understand what inspires young fans. They value entertainment, thrills, and interaction, and they are very influenced by social networks. According to a latest survey, 75% of young football fans use social media to follow their preferred teams and players. Therefore, it is key to leverage social media to engage with young fans.


One effective way to do so is by creating engaging content that resonates young audiences. This can include behind-the-scenes footage like player interviews, and fan-made. In addition, football clubs can also use social media to engage with young fans by responding to feedback and creating live streams.


Another way to engage young fans is by providing them with a sense of belonging. Football clubs can create fan zones that run events and competitions, and offer limited edition merchandise to make young fans feel part of the team. This sense of belonging can be further increased by partnering with popular sports figures to promote the team and engage with young fans.


Additionally, football clubs can also engage young fans through charity programs. These programs can include educational workshops, coaching clinics, and charity events that promote football development and community engagement. By investing time and resources into community outreach programs, football clubs can build strong relationships with young fans and their families.


To further engage young fans, football clubs can also use progress to create interactive experiences. This can include augmented reality games that allow fans to immerse in the game. According to a recent survey, 60% of young football fans would be interested in participating in virtual football experiences.


Finally, football clubs can also engage young fans by providing them with a sense of ownership. This can be done by creating a representative group that allows young fans to have a say in team decisions, hosting feedback and recognizing fan achievements and contributions.


In conclusion, engaging young fans in football requires a multi-faceted approach that leverages online platforms, creates a sense of ownership, provides opportunities for social impact, and uses progress to create interactive experiences. By understanding what drives young fans and implementing the strategies outlined above, football clubs can build a supportive fan base that will drive the sport's growth and success for years to come.
